Transaction 67f0ea7181473070104329ed4b580c7cd5ceb3a6220c3de4e5395689d4ab47f7
1 Input
1 Outputs
- 67f0ea7181473070104329ed4b580c7cd5ceb3a6220c3de4e5395689d4ab47f7:0
value 1655509
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u